Raspberry Chocolate Chip Tart

Servings

8

Prep Time

30 Minutes

Cook Time

45 Minutes

Total Time

1 Hour 15 Min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 whole pre-made tart crust
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 1 1/2 cups fresh raspberries
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 2 tsp vanilla extract
  • 3 large eggs

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Blind bake the tart crust for 10 minutes. Remove from the oven and let it cool.
  3. Evenly sprinkle chocolate chips over the bottom of the cooled tart crust.
  4. In a bowl, whisk together the heavy cream, sugar, vanilla extract, and eggs until smooth.
  5. Carefully pour the cream mixture over the chocolate chips in the crust.
  6. Arrange fresh raspberries gently on top of the cream mixture.
  7. Bake in the preheated oven for 35-40 minutes until the filling is set and slightly golden.
  8. Allow the tart to cool completely before serving.
